A 16-year-old boy was killed and two other people were injured after the stolen car they were in hit a pole during a police chase early Monday morning on Detroit’s east side, according to Detroit police.

The crash came after a reported carjacking at 1:55 a.m. in the area of Van Dyke and Outer Drive. A police patrol saw the 1994 Dodge Duster shortly afterward, and a pursuit ensued, Sgt. Michael Woody with Detroit Police Department said.
The Dodge hit a pole at a high speed on 7 Mile Road east of Hoover Street, ejecting and killing one while trapping the two others inside. Emergency rigs used the Jaws of Life to pull them out, and they remain in serious condition with non-life-threatening injuries, Woody said.
